Who is ‘Jamna Pyari’, or What is ‘Jamna Pyari’? Puzzled by the same? Then M’Town audience has to be patient till Onam. The intriguing question is put forth in the recently released trailer of Jamna Pyari. Helmed by Thomas Sebastian, who earlier directed Mammootty-starrer Maya Bazar, the latest flick Jamna Pyari will be an out and out entertainer, say its makers.

Jamna Pyari is the journey of humour, love and drama revolving around Vasoottan and his confidantes. “The film revolves around Vasoottan, an auto driver, who is a very kind and helpful guy. He is a person who always sees life in a positive light irrespective of any hardship he has to face,” says P R Arun, who has penned the script. Kunchacko Boban dons the role of Vasoottan in the movie.

Jamna Pyari imparting a social message in a light manner, talks on the sidelines of people’s attitude of escapism too. “Kerala is one such place where suicide rates are high. It is because, people when encountered with the trial and tribulations of life, mostly have the attitude to think ‘it is impossible to overcome or solve’ and easily accept the failures. But our protagonist is a person who always believes in being positive. In Vasoottan’s dictionary there is nothing called intractable,” says Arun who has turned as independent scriptwriter with the film.

Jamna Pyari is also a flavourful jaunt of love. “Parvathy is Vasoottan’s heartthrob but to reach to her, he has to unlock a lock. And film traverses Vasoottan’s search for the key to reach his princess,” says Arun. Miss Kerala 2014 winner Gayathri Suresh essays the role of Parvathy. Gayathri will be playing a simple lovable girl in the film. “Parvathy is the complete opposite to Vasoottan. She has a negative attitude towards life, with lot of fear and anxiety,” he adds. Maniyanpilla Raju portrays Parvathy’s father Ramachandran.

Suraj Venjaramoodu plays prominent role in the movie. “He plays K P Sabu, close friend of Vasoottan and Muthumani plays his wife,” adds Arun.

The plot happening in and around the locales of Thrissur, will also be the first film where Kunchacko Boban will be trying out Thrissur slang. “He will be speaking Thrissur dialect but in the movie various characters will be speaking different slangs as these days people from different region reside at same place. For instance Joy Mathew, who plays Prakash ettan, will be speaking Kozhikode dialect while Tony played by Neeraj Madhav speaks Kochi slang,” informs Arun. Renji Panicker as Sreedharan, Aju Varghese, Anumol and Sijoy Varghese also form the rest of the cast. “After 12 years, actress Roja will be coming back to Mollywood,” he adds.

Gopi Sundar has composed the music for Santhosh Varma and Hari Narayan’s lyrics. Camera is wielded by Anishlal R S.  Jamna Pyari produced by Jaison Elamgulam will be a Onam release.
